Are You a First-Time Credit Card Applicant? Know What You Should Consider

Submitted by admin on May 17th, 2024

A decade ago, only a few used to own a credit card due to strict eligibility criteria to get it. Naturally, it was a luxury thing. The banking and overall financial landscape has undergone a significant change. Nowadays, credit cards are easily accessible to many of society. It’s a password for a little more freedom and convenience. If you are applying for a credit card, this blog is a guideline.

How Credit Cards Function

Before knowing the procedure to get a credit card, you should have a clear understanding of the credit card basics. A credit card is a plastic card that is issued by a bank or any other financial institution. With it, you will have easy access to pre-set credit limits that you can use for different purposes like buying something or availing services. You must pay off the used credit within a specific period.

A credit card works similarly to a loan. The only difference is you can spend up to a certain credit limit instead of getting approved cash upfront. The issuer sets the limit and you have to pay off a certain amount to the lending institution by the end of each billing cycle.

Every month, you will get a statement containing your transaction details and total dues. It’s a must to pay off your bills in a timely to avoid interest charges. This will also help you build up a good credit score.

Eligibility Criteria

You must meet certain eligibility criteria to apply for a credit card in India. These include:

Nationality: The applicant must be an Indian citizen or an NRI (Non-Resident Indian) to apply for a credit card.

Minimum Age: 18 years (In some banks, this minimum age is 21 years)

Income: You must have a steady source of income for your credit card application to be approved. The minimum requirements vary from one bank to another and range between Rs 15, 000 and Rs 25, 000 per month.

Credit Score: First-time applicants usually don’t have a credit history. However, it’s important to build up and maintain a good credit history from the very beginning. A credit score of 750 or more is a good one and can increase the chance that your application will get approved.

Choose the Right Credit Card

You should choose your credit card according to your requirements and spending habits. First-time credit card applicants must remember the following factors:

Fees: Focus on cost minimization by using credit cards with no or low annual fees. Some banks provide lifetime free credit cards to their clients. This is a good starting point for first-time credit card users.

Rewards: Choose a credit card that offers benefits and rewards that suit your personal needs and lifestyle. If you shop online now and then, apply for a credit card offering higher cashback or reward points on online purchases.

Eligibility: Ensure you have the eligibility criteria for the credit card you are applying for. Some banks provide credit cards specially designed for young professionals or students.

Brand: Always consider the reputation of the credit card issuer. Work with a well-known bank with an excellent track record of consumer security and service.
